Randy A Carlisle commented about Astro screen on Jun 26, 2021 at 1:38 pm

TO NOTE https://www.flickr.com/photos/racphotography/481914998 This photo of Screen #1, taken with My P&S Film Camera back on February 2 1999, is The Astro Drive In Theatre located in Oak Cliff (Dallas) Texas. DEMOLISHED. This drive in opened in 1968/69. Closed November 1998 Due to Fire in the Concessions Stand. Altho it could have been re-built, it was demolished in February of 1999. The Last operating Drive In Theatre in Dallas now gone. Photo Taken: February 2 1999 Photo Taken By: Randy A. Carlisle ALL photos (Unless otherwise stated) Copyright RAC Photography

Randy A Carlisle commented about Ideal Theatre on Jan 17, 2021 at 4:18 pm

This photo… Ideal Theatre, located at 4306 (Original address is 4304) Bryan Street, in the East section of Dallas Texas. Closed. “Opened in 1916 as part of Ed Foy’s Neighborhood Theatre chain, the 550 sear Ideal Theatre was popular with children & adults alike. During WW-I, the theatre invited recently returned servicemen to speak about their experiences "over there”. On October 26 1928, a fire blazed through the Ideal, igniting reels of nitrate film & collapsing the roof. The building was repaired & has been used for various purposes, but never again as a theatre.“ Information taken from the Arcadia Publishing Book "Historic Dallas Theatres” by D Troy Sherrod.. Today, it appears to be occupied/used as a Church. Update! Today (July 2019), it’s now known as Dallas Carpet & Fine Floors.. Open.. Randy A Carlisle commented about Palace Theatre on Jul 30, 2020 at 10:43 am

This was known originally as The Star Theatre, a silent movie theatre.. Later becoming known as The Palace Theatre. Today, Western Auto took over the building. The Palace has been closed at least some 55-60+ years. RAC Photography – The above capture, I took back in Dec 2010!!
